Welcome to Oak Dale ...
Oak Dale is located in Overton County<1>.
From the 2010 Census (the most recent Census number we have), Oak Dale had a population of 212 people.<2> (see below for details).
Oak Dale is 940 feet [287 m] above sea level.<3>.
Time Zone: Oak Dale lies in the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T) and observes daylight saving time
Note: If you travel east from Oak Dale (for example, toward Elgin), you will leave Central Time and cross into the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T).
Area Code for Oak Dale: 931
